The SFP port is a built-in optical port of a Gigabit Ethernet switch, so it cannot be directly connected with a twisted pair or a jumper. It needs to be connected to an optical module first, and then it can be transmitted with an optical fiber patch cord. The most common switch normal ports are RJ45 interfaces, while uplink ports are typically SFP or SFP+. Generally, uplink ports' physical interface is higher than normal ports. For example, a switch with RJ45 downlinks has SFP uplinks, and a switch with SFP downlinks has SFP+ . What is a switch uplink port, and how does it differ from a standard port? A switch uplink port, also known as a trunk port, is a specialized port on a network switch that connects to a router or higher-level networking devices.
